创建一张学生表,包含以下信息,学号,姓名,年龄,性别,家庭住址,联系电话.@修改学生表的结构,添加一列信息,学历; @按照性别分组查询所有的平均年龄
时间: 2023-04-01 11:01:58 浏览: 136
好的,我可以回答这个问题。
创建学生表的 SQL 语句如下:
CREATE TABLE student (
id INT PRIMARY KEY,
name VARCHAR(20),
age INT,
gender VARCHAR(2),
address VARCHAR(50),
phone VARCHAR(20)
);
修改学生表的结构,添加学历列的 SQL 语句如下:
ALTER TABLE student ADD education VARCHAR(20);
按照性别分组查询所有学生的平均年龄的 SQL 语句如下:
SELECT gender, AVG(age) FROM student GROUP BY gender;
相关问题
使用mysql.请设计一张学生表,选择合理的数据类型保存学号、姓名、性别、出生日期、入学日期、家庭住址信息
MySQL是一个开源的关系型数据库管理系统,被广泛应用于Web应用程序的开发中。下面是设计一张学生表的示例:
学生表:
| 字段名 | 数据类型 | 描述 |
| -- | --- |
| 学号 | VARCHAR(20) | 学生的学号 |
| 姓名 | VARCHAR(50) | 学生的姓名 |
| 性别 | ENUM('男', '女') | 学生的性别,只能取男或女 |
| 出生日期 | DATE | 学生的出生日期 |
| 入学日期 | DATE | 学生的入学日期 |
| 家庭住址 | VARCHAR(100) | 学生的家庭住址信息 |
使用mysql设计一张学生表,选择合适的数据类型保存学号、姓名、性别、出生日期、入学日期、家庭住址信息. 并且插入数据
可以使用以下的 SQL 语句创建一张学生表:
```
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50) NOT NULL,
gender ENUM('male', 'female') NOT NULL,
birthday DATE,
enrollment_date DATE,
address VARCHAR(100)
);
```
其中,id 为学号,使用 INT 类型,设为主键;name 为姓名,使用 VARCHAR 类型,长度为 50;gender 为性别,使用 ENUM 类型,只能取 'male' 或 'female' 两个值;birthday 为出生日期,使用 DATE 类型;enrollment_date 为入学日期,也使用 DATE 类型;address 为家庭住址信息,使用 VARCHAR 类型,长度为 100。
插入数据可以使用以下的 SQL 语句:
```
INSERT INTO students (id, name, gender, birthday, enrollment_date, address)
VALUES
(1001, '张三', 'male', '2000-01-01', '2018-09-01', '北京市海淀区xx路xx号'),
(1002, '李四', 'female', '2001-02-02', '2019-09-01', '上海市浦东新区xx路xx号'),
(1003, '王五', 'male', '2002-03-03', '2020-09-01', '广州市天河区xx路xx号');
```
这样就向学生表中插入了三条数据。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![cpp](https://img-home.csdnimg.cn/images/20210720083646.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)